My 6-month-old kitten got spayed two days ago and refuses to eat any food or drink water. Why is this and what can I do?

This is highly abnormal, it could be due to pain or due to an infection. You need to take her back to your vet today in order to be checked, the vet will probably give you some more pain killers and possibly an antibiotics injection.

    I recommend to call the veterinarian who preformed the surgery right away. They may want to examine her for any evidence of infection or dehydration. They may also recommend to come in and pick up medications. Pets can get infections or side effects from sedation and if they are not eating or drinking, they can get worse quickly.     Poor Stormy! I recommend to have her kidney values checked. Its rare but after surgery, sometimes evidence of kidney damage will become apparent. You veterinarian may also want to start anti-vomiting medication and an appetite stimulant. You must also make sure she remains hydrated and you may need to learn to give subcutaneous fluids at home.
